1. What is a logo?

A logo can be considered the soul of a brand. It is a visual representation, often consisting of a creative and unique expression of the business name or an easily recognizable symbol. A logo is more than just an image; it carries the values, messages and emotions that the brand wants to convey to its customers. From websites and social media to business cards and promotional materials, logos appear everywhere, helping the brand to be present in the minds of consumers.

An impressive logo will attract attention at first sight. It not only helps to distinguish one brand from another but also shows the style and identity of the business. When consumers see the logo, they not only recognize the brand but also feel the core values ​​that the brand represents. Therefore, designing a suitable and creative logo is extremely necessary to build a strong brand.

2. Why does a logo play an important role in successfully promoting a business?

In an age where consumers are exposed to thousands of advertisements every day, getting noticed is a challenge. Research shows that the average person is exposed to around 3,000 advertisements every day, and most of them are easily ignored. This is where your logo becomes a standout element, helping your brand stand out from the sea of ​​messages.

A clear and memorable logo not only attracts attention but also creates a strong first impression. The time consumers spend evaluating a logo is only about 10 seconds, but those few seconds are enough to create a feeling about the brand. A logo is more than just an image; it is a powerful tool that can influence purchasing behavior and build customer loyalty. A great logo needs to be consistent in color scheme and visual form, creating a deep connection with consumers.

3. How to design a logo that fits your brand

Designing a logo is not just a creative task, but also a strategic and thoughtful process. To create a logo that fits your brand, you need to have a clear understanding of your brand identity, your target audience, and the message you want to convey. Here are some tips to help you determine the best logo design style to create an effective and memorable image for your brand.

3.1. Text Logo

Text logos are one of the most popular choices in modern logo design. With this style, the company name becomes the main visual image, creating a simple yet powerful look. A text logo often uses distinctive fonts to create a unique impression, thereby making the brand easily recognizable and memorable. Not only suitable for small businesses, text logos are also favored by many large corporations because of their modernity and versatility.

When designing a text logo, it is important to choose a font that fits your brand personality. If your brand is dynamic and youthful, a sans-serif typeface may be a good choice. Conversely, if your brand is aiming for elegance and sophistication, a serif font can create that feeling. In particular, if your company name is not too long (1-2 words) or difficult to abbreviate, a text logo is a great choice.

One thing to keep in mind is to check the meaning of your company name in different languages. This will not only help you avoid unnecessary misunderstandings but also protect your brand from risks when expanding into international markets. A name with a negative meaning in another language can have a negative impact on your brand image.

3.2. Abbreviation Logo

An acronym logo is a creative and effective solution for businesses with long or complex names. Using acronyms simplifies and creates a more memorable image. A great example is NASA, whose acronym is much easier to read and understand than the full name of the agency. By using acronyms, you can create a brand that is easily recognized in the minds of your customers.

When designing an acronym logo, pay attention to choosing a font that stands out and is easy to read. An interesting font can make a difference, but avoid using too many different fonts, as this can reduce the consistency and professionalism of the logo. In particular, acronyms need to be easy to understand and pronounce so that customers can easily remember them.

Another thing to keep in mind is to make sure that your abbreviated logo is not too similar to other brands. This will not only help you avoid legal issues but also create a unique brand identity. Experiment with different fonts and consider color combinations to find the style that best suits your brand.

3.3. Symbol Logo

Symbols are an important part of logo design, acting as a visual focal point for your brand. These images can be abstract symbols, realistic photographs, or hand-drawn designs, depending on your brand’s goals and style. If you want to create a memorable and memorable mark for your brand, a symbol logo is the ideal choice.

When designing an iconic logo, it is important not to use too many colors or complex details. The logo should be simple, easily recognizable, and clearly convey the brand message. Additionally, make sure that your logo can work well across multiple platforms, from print to digital. It is also important to design backup versions of your logo so that you can use it flexibly in different situations.

Finally, don’t forget that your logo needs to look good in black and white. This ensures that it remains recognizable even in situations where colour is not an option, such as on printed materials or in emergency situations. A strong logo will always be able to stick in the minds of customers, no matter the conditions.

3.4. Abstract Logo

Abstract logos are a unique branding option that allows you to break away from concrete images and explore new concepts. Instead of using recognizable symbols such as product images or specific objects, abstract logos focus on using shapes and colors to convey emotions and meanings. This not only creates a unique logo but also helps your brand stand out from the competition.

One of the biggest benefits of abstract logos is their versatility. They can be applied to a variety of industries, from technology to art to financial services. By choosing the right shapes and colors, you can create a logo that is rich in meaning and emotion, and will grab the attention of your customers. An abstract logo is more than just an image; it is a work of art that reflects the essence of your brand.

However, when pursuing uniqueness, you also need to pay attention to semantics. The logo must be able to convey the company's message at first glance. If an abstract logo is too difficult to understand, customers may feel confused, and this may lead them to ignore your brand. Therefore, balancing creativity and understandability is the key to designing a successful abstract logo.

3.5. Mascot Logo

Mascot logos are one of the interesting designs that bring fun and closeness to the brand. These symbols are often cartoon characters or animals, easily attract attention and make a strong impression on consumers. Human psychology responds faster to faces and images of characters than to abstract symbols, which makes mascot logos easy to recognize and remember.

One of the great things about mascot logos is their adaptability. Over time, you can tweak and change your mascot while still maintaining its identity. For example, if your company wants to change its brand image from more serious to more fun, you can refresh your mascot without losing the brand values ​​you’ve built. This is important for maintaining a connection with your customers and refreshing your brand image.

However, designing a mascot logo is not an easy task. It requires thorough market research to ensure that the character you create is truly relevant to your target audience. Without proper attention to this aspect, you risk creating a negative or inappropriate image that will damage your brand. Therefore, invest time and effort in developing a mascot that can create a positive connection with your customers.

3.6. Coat of Arms Logo

Coat of arms logos are an ancient form of design that often combines both text and imagery to create a powerful and meaningful symbol. These logos have been used since ancient times to identify and represent social groups, and they still hold that value today. With their traditional and dignified appearance, coat of arms logos are often used by educational institutions, governments, and family businesses.

One advantage of a coat of arms logo is the ability to create a unique and distinctive image for your brand. If your company has an interesting history or wants to convey prestige, a coat of arms logo is a good choice. However, designing such a logo requires careful consideration. The more complex the images and patterns in the logo, the more difficult it is to recognize, especially on small media platforms such as business cards.

When designing a Coat of Arms logo, try to simplify the image and use easily recognizable elements. This will not only make the logo clearer but also make it easier to apply across different platforms. A logo that is easy to read and understand will help your brand make a strong impression on customers, thereby strengthening your position in the market.

3.7. Logo type combining many styles

Combination logos are a versatile design solution that combines text and symbols to create a powerful and recognizable image. These logos not only clearly convey the brand’s content and message, but also complement each other, making them easy for customers to remember. This combination is ideal for brands that want to create a comprehensive image, where each element can work independently without losing the overall consistency.

One of the benefits of a combination logo is the ability to change it in the future. Over time, your brand’s needs and goals may change, and a combination logo allows you to adjust elements without having to completely redesign it. This is especially useful for businesses that are growing or expanding their market. For example, you may want to change the colors or fonts to reflect your new brand style, while still keeping the familiar icon.

However, a major challenge when designing a combination logo is to avoid creating a cluttered and confusing image. Many designers get caught up in trying to combine too many elements, resulting in a logo that is unclear. To avoid this, identify which element is the most important in your logo. If you want to emphasize the image, choose a light and simple font. Conversely, if the text is the main element, the image should be designed in a neutral tone, so as not to take attention away from the text.
